Seated Peasant (Cézanne)

| Artist | Paul Cézanne |
| Year | c. 1892–96 |
| Medium | Oil on canvas |
| Dimensions | 54.6 cm × 45.1 cm (21.5 in × 17.8 in) |
| Location |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York |
| Accession | 1997.60.2 |
Seated Peasant is a late 19th-century painting by Paul Cézanne. Done in oil on canvas, the work depicts a seated peasant, likely a worker at Jas de Bouffan, Cézanne's family estate in Aix-en-Provence. The painting's age is unknown but credibly dated between 1892 and 1896.[1] It is currently in the collection of the Metropolitan Museum of Art.[2]
